Aspose.Words for Java 25.6 Release Notes
Major Features
There are 64 improvements and fixes in this regular monthly release. The most notable are:
- Multi-Page Export: Added multi-page export to raster image formats (PNG/JPG/etc.) with customizable layouts (Horizontal/Vertical/Grid).
- MathML Connectors: Added rendering for connector lines in MathML, ensuring more accurate formula visualization.
- Math Formula Wrapping: Improved rendering to correctly wrap formulas with multiple slashes, enhancing layout clarity.
- Waterfall Chart Legends: Added legend rendering for “Waterfall” charts, improving data understanding and chart completeness.

Public API and Backward Incompatible Changes
This section lists public API changes that were introduced in Aspose.Words 25.6. It includes not only new and obsoleted public methods, but also a description of any changes in the behavior behind the scenes in Aspose.Words which may affect existing code. Any behavior introduced that could be seen as regression and modifies the existing behavior is especially important and is documented here.
Added multi-page export to raster image formats (PNG/JPG/etc.) with customizable layouts (Horizontal/Vertical/Grid).
Related issue: WORDSNET-28060
Introduced new public property in Aspose.Words.Saving.ImageSaveOptions class:
/// <summary>
/// Gets or sets the layout used when rendering multiple pages into a single output.
/// </summary>
/// <remarks>
/// <para>
/// Use one of the factory methods of <see cref="Saving.MultiPageLayout"/> to configure this property.
/// </para>
/// <para>
/// For <see cref="SaveFormat.Tiff"/> the default value is <see cref="MultiPageLayout.TiffFrames"/>.
/// For other formats the default value is <see cref="MultiPageLayout.SinglePage"/>.
/// </para>
/// <para>
/// This property has effect only when saving to the following formats:
/// <see cref="SaveFormat.Jpeg"/>, <see cref="SaveFormat.Gif"/>, <see cref="SaveFormat.Png"/>,
/// <see cref="SaveFormat.Bmp"/>, <see cref="SaveFormat.Tiff"/>, <see cref="SaveFormat.WebP"/>
/// </para>
/// </remarks>
public MultiPageLayout PageLayout { get; set; }
and added a new factory class to create the muli-page layout configurations in Aspose.Words.Saving namespace:
/// <summary>
/// Defines a layout for rendering multiple pages into a single output.
/// </summary>
/// <remarks>
/// Use one of the static factory methods to create a layout configuration.
/// </remarks>
public sealed class MultiPageLayout
{
/// <summary>
/// Creates a layout where all specified pages are rendered vertically one below the other in a single output.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="verticalGap">The vertical gap between pages in points.</param>
public static MultiPageLayout Vertical(float verticalGap);
/// <summary>
/// Creates a layout in which all specified pages are rendered horizontally side by side,
/// left to right, in a single output.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="horizontalGap">The horizontal gap between pages in points.</param>
public static MultiPageLayout Horizontal(float horizontalGap);
/// <summary>
/// Creates a layout in which pages are rendered left-to-right, top-to-bottom, in a grid with the
/// specified number of columns.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="columns">The number of columns in the layout. Must be greater than zero.</param>
/// <param name="horizontalGap">The horizontal gap between columns in points.</param>
/// <param name="verticalGap">The vertical gap between rows in points.</param>
/// <exception cref="ArgumentOutOfRangeException">Thrown if <paramref name="columns"/> is less than or equal to zero.</exception>
public static MultiPageLayout Grid(int columns, float horizontalGap, float verticalGap);
/// <summary>
/// Creates a layout where each page is rendered as a separate frame in a multi-frame TIFF image.
/// Applicable only to TIFF image formats.
/// </summary>
public static MultiPageLayout TiffFrames()
/// <summary>
/// Creates a layout that renders only the first of specified pages.
/// </summary>
public static MultiPageLayout SinglePage()
/// <summary>
/// Gets or sets the background color of the output.
/// The default is <see cref="Color.Empty"/>.
/// </summary>
public Color BackColor { get; set; }
/// <summary>
/// Gets or sets the color of the pages border.
/// The default is <see cref="Color.Empty"/>.
/// </summary>
public Color BorderColor { get; set }
/// <summary>
/// Gets or sets the width of the pages border.
/// The default is 0.
/// </summary>
public float BorderWidth { get; set; }
}
